Microsoft reported in October that Chinese hackers had compromised thousands of TP-Link routers to launch cyberattacks against Western targets, including government organizations and Defense Department suppliers. The company’s routers are widely used across federal agencies, including the Defense Department and NASA. The Justice Department is also examining whether TP-Link’s significantly lower pricing violates federal anti-monopoly laws, the report said.
